Overall Meaning

In "Lights Camera Action," Remy Ma showcases her confidence and style while rapping about her love for the old-school hip-hop era. She opens the song by describing her outfit, declaring her love for 80's fashion, and boasting her name airbrushed on her pants. The lyrics talk about her be-boy stance, 54 letters, and Kangol hat. She then talks about how people can't help but stop and stare at her unique fashion style. The song's verses are filled with iconic hip-hop references, from her spandex outfit, which stops traffic to picking a soldier that can handle a magnum.


The chorus of the song instructs men and women to bring their guns and 9's to her performance because Remy Ma is on the microphone. Ultimately, "Lights Camera Action" showcases Remy Ma's confidence and style, as well as her ability to rap with the best of them. This song is an homage to the golden era of hip-hop and a declaration of Remy Ma's talent.
